当我使用重新映射的密钥访问插件命令时,为什么vim会说“Not Connected”

时间:2012-01-10 17:44:14

标签: vim nerdtree

我正在尝试使用F9来允许NERDTree切换。所以我做的是以下内容:

nnoremap <silent> <F9> :NERDTreeToggle<CR>

当我点击F9时,我从vim

返回以下消息
Not Connected
Not Connected

Press ENTER or type a command to continue

如果我:source ~/.vimrc,我对F9的重映射按预期工作,然后按预期切换NerdTree。

此外,如果我在命令模式的任何时候使用命令:NERDTreeToggle,它也可以。

有什么想法吗?

2 个答案:

答案 0 :(得分:0)

使用@ michaelmichael和@ romainl的建议,我能够确定我有一个覆盖密钥。

答案是......使用:详细地图调试它,然后查看是否需要禁用它。

答案 1 :(得分:0)

我遇到了同样的问题 - debugger.py目录中有debugger.vim~./vim/plugin。我删除了这些未使用的插件,我的映射恢复正常。

在将OS X升级为Mavericks之后曝光。